Cat killings launch investigation

File photo.

An investigation has been launched following reports of the killing of four cats near Papamoa.

Tauranga City Council Animal Services team leader Brent Lincoln says a number of dogs are believed to be responsible for the attacks.

The team is appealing for information.

'Our sincere condolences go out to the owners who have lost their beloved pets,” says Brent.

'If anyone has any information, photos or video footage that can identify the dogs responsible, please contact Council on 07 577 7000.

'Please ensure all pets are safe and secure while Animal Services conducts its investigation.

'To report a roaming dog or a dog attack please call Council on 07 577 7000 – our customer service centre is available 24/7.”
